What’s to like about Macs
no anti-virus / no anti-spyware / no bloat-ware
iLife: GarageBand, iMovie, iPhoto, iDVD
built-in two-way firewall / invisible on network
EASY set-up for WiFi and networks (even Windows servers!)
EASY access to printers, scanners, any peripherals
Built-in Mic & Web-Cam for easy tele-conferences (iChat & Skype)
PDF support built-in
- No Adobe Reader or Adobe updates or Adobe plug-ins!
Firefox browser, works just like in Windows & Linux!
EASY set up of secure non-Admin public access accounts
-Deep Freeze for Mac

Dell vs Mac - 13” laptop
Dell Vostro 1320 MacBook
Intel 2.2 Core 2 Duo Intel 2.13 Core 2 Duo
2 GB RAM 2 GB RAM
160 GB HD 160 GB HD
NVIDIA® GeForce 9300M GS 256MB NVIDIA GeForce 9400M 256MB
WiFi a/g/n - bluetooth - 8x DVD-RW DL WiFi a/g/n - bluetooth - 8x DVD-RW DL
Windows Vista Ultimate OS X Snow Leopard
$1,159.26 $949.00
6
Dell vs Mac - 15” laptop
Latitude E6500 MacBook Pro
Intel 2.53 Core 2 Duo Intel 2.53 Core 2 Duo
4 GB RAM 4 GB RAM
250 GB HD 250 GB HD
NVIDIA Quadro NVS 160M - 256GB NVIDIA GeForce 9400M - 256GB
WiFi a/g/n - bluetooth - 8x DVD-RW DL WiFi a/g/n - bluetooth - 8x DVD-RW DL
Windows Vista Ultimate OS X 10.6 Snow Leopard
$1,576.66 (-$22.34) $1,599.00
7
Dell vs Mac - desktop NO monitor
OptiPlex 760 Ultra Small Form Factor Mac Mini
Intel Celeron 2.2 GHz Intel 2.26 Core 2 Duo
1 GB RAM 1 GB RAM
160 GB HD 120 GB HD
Integrated Intel Video GMA 4500 NVIDIA GeForce 9400M - 128MB
8x DVD-RW WiFi a/g/n - bluetooth - 8x DVD-RW DL
Windows Vista Ultimate OS X Snow Leopard
$780.82 $684.00
